tip: when i used to work on old BMC engines with canister type oil filters, like your 135 has, the nack was to hold the canister from turning with one hand and turn the bolt with the other. remove the bolt then the canister.

The spring went up inside because you put it on the wrong way round the first time. I don't think you need a washer if you put it on wide side up as you did this time. The danger of putting the washer on (especially as it was a very tight fit) is that it may jam on the centre bolt and stop the spring from performing its function correctly.

Well done both of you. That washer not only stops the spring going up into the filter but seals the bottom of the filter element so that only filtered oil is pumped around the engine. Work shop tip; when you need a washer or nut from your tray of "handy bits" lay a sheet of polythene or paper on the bench and tip your tray onto it. Spread the contents out and it will be much easier to find what you are looking for and when you have finished looking gather the sheet up and tip it back into the tray
